Done the same thing on Cathy's 620, she tried race pattern and has never looked back, the only fly in the ointment being that as you said in your case, Cathy needed a longer toe peg.

So I took the original toe peg to Carl at Race Supplies Direct, 15 mins later a longer toe peg that accepted the original rubber toe peg part but was now none adjustable, that is a small price to pay for easier gear changes with out the pain of the end of the toe peg digging into your foot.

Take the toe peg to any machine shop, they should be able to make you a new one.
